Joe Cheshire is in his fourth season as a full-time assistant
coach, following one season with the Bulldogs as a part-time
assistant. He's worked with Butler's running backs and defensive
backs, and currently handles the team's inside linebackers. He's
also Butler's recruiting coordinator. Cheshire joined the Bulldogs
in 2004, after spending two seasons as offensive backs coach at
DePauw University. In his final season at DePauw, the Tigers led
the Southern Collegiate Athletic Conference in rushing yards per
game in 2003. The son of former Butler football player Jim Cheshire
(75), Joe was a four-year football letterwinner at DePauw. He was
the Tigers' offensive Most Valuable Player in 1997, and he served
as a football team captain in 1998. He earned all-conference
recognition as a junior, when he led DePauw in pass receiving.
Cheshire received a B. A. degree from DePauw in 1999 and began a
brief business career before returning to the football field in
2002.
